## Support

Querylint enforces the Fennwick SQL style rules on all `.sql` files in plugin packages. Violations block CI; there are no warnings, only errors. Rule definitions live in `rules/` and are versioned with each release — pin your plugin to a rule version to avoid surprise breakage. Do not disable rules inline; request an exemption instead. Check the rule reference and changelog before filing anything. For rule clarifications, exemption requests, or false-positive reports, reach the Querylint maintainers at the address below.

escalation mailbox, yajeg-bageg: quenax.olidor@lumiccorp.internal

## Environments — Lintbase Baseline Service

The baseline file for Quillcheck static analysis is generated per environment and must never be copied between them. Dev baselines regenerate on every merge; staging regenerates nightly; production baselines change only through a reviewed pipeline run. Reviewers should confirm that any diff touching suppression entries references a tracked finding. For reference during review, the production environment currently runs with the configuration values shown below.

deployment values, taweg-bajop:
[fenvan]
port = 5672
team = holmir
host = fenvan.orvexio.example
region = lower-1
access_code = ac_b98bc6
timeout_ms = 1500

## Step 2: Wire up the workflow engine

Welcome aboard! We're retiring the old cron tangle on the Mossgate box and moving every scheduled job into Loomflow, our workflow engine. Each migrated job becomes a Loomflow DAG, so retries and alerting come for free. Before your first run, copy .env.template to .env in the loomflow-jobs repo, set the scheduler host and timezone as shown in the sample, and then drop the Loomflow service credential onto the next line.

sealed setting: VAULT_KEY20=c8ea1e419912889df6b4

## 3.4.0 — Key rotation

We rotated the upload-signing key for Pixelhush, the EXIF scrubbing service. Photos uploaded before the rotation were scrubbed correctly; no customer action needed. If a user reports a "signature mismatch" error on upload, ask them to retry — stale clients refresh automatically within an hour. For manual verification of scrubbed bundles, use the new key below.

deploy key for kaduf-bagep: bky6_NNeq4d